Dance As Exercise A Fun Way to Get Fit

September 6, 2009 by Fun Fitness · Leave a Comment 

Seeing the viewing figures of dance shows on TV, spending time and energy on the dance floor has become very popular. So, if you want to improve your health, dance as exercise might be the activity that we all needs to stick with the cardio workouts known to be so very good for your health. Studies, One out of the UK and one from Italy, presented at the most recent annual meeting of the American College of Sports Medicine in Seattle suggested that dancing could be the way to go. The active-play phenomenon started by Wii Sports now spreads to your whole body thanks to Wii Fit and the pressure-sensitive Wii Balance Board, which comes bundled with it. Used together players will experience an extensive array of fun, dynamic and surprisingly challenging activities, including aerobics, yoga, muscle stretches and balance oriented games.
